Formulation

Formulation re: Other

Pure creatine monohydrate, a precursor to creatine phosphate, which is necessary to fuel muscle contractions. Creatine plays a vital role in the creation of ATP, the primary compound which converts food into energy. When high concentrations of creatine are present, the body can quickly release ATP to sustain high-powered muscle contraction.
